Requirements
- Obtains and records patients vital signs and weight
- Assists providers with patient examinations
- Performs medical procedures and wound care as needed
- Administers and documents medication administration and patient chart (oral and intramuscular injection)
- Collections urine, blood, and sputum specimens from patients for testing and performs routine laboratory tests
- Reviews providers’ orders, lab requests, and closes out tasks, and providers’ nurse buckets
- Interviews patients to determine medical problems and conditions, and documents in the chart for the provider
- Affixes patients with scheduling follow-up appointments
- Completes and submits prior authorizations for imaging, medication (Nexplanon, ParaGard, and other procedures) as needed
- Follows up on patient requests as ordered by the provider (e.g., medication refills, telephone inquiries from affiliated agencies, and other specialty providers)
- Maintains health department STD treatment lists and verifies records
- Communicates with affiliated agencies regarding test results and tracks consultation reports
- Supports chronic care management team
- Affixes new supplies and disposes of expired or damaged supplies
- Administers COVID-19 testing, vaccinations, and patient education
- Maintains medical equipment and monitors for inspection, expiration
- Affixes onboarding for new CAN’s, LPNs, and RN’s
- Supports community education programs and health fairs
- Administers incoordinated flu vaccine clinics
- Provides education to patients as needed
- Performs other duties as assigned
